> Compute, base.py: _wait_until_running fails for Rackspace
> ---------------------------------------------------------
>
> Key: LIBCLOUD-176
> URL: https://issues.apache.org/jira/browse/LIBCLOUD-176
> Project: Libcloud
> Issue Type: Bug
> Affects Versions: 0.8.0
> Reporter: Jouke Waleson
> Labels: beginners, rackspace
>
> The Rackspace driver's list_nodes method will not include a brand new node
> right away. Therefore, the following code will fail when being called after
> deploy_node.
> while time.time() < end:
> nodes = self.list_nodes()
> nodes = list([n for n in nodes if n.uuid == node.uuid])
> if len(nodes) == 0:
> raise LibcloudError(value=('Booted node[%s] ' % node
> + 'is missing from list_nodes.'),
> driver=self)
> if len(nodes) > 1:
> raise LibcloudError(value=('Booted single node[%s], ' % node
> + 'but multiple nodes have same UUID'),
> driver=self)
> node = nodes[0]
> if (node.public_ips and node.state == NodeState.RUNNING):
> return node
> else:
> time.sleep(wait_period)
> continue
> I fixed this by rewriting it like this:
> while time.time() < end:
> nodes = self.list_nodes()
> nodes = list([n for n in nodes if n.uuid == node.uuid])
> if len(nodes) > 1:
> raise LibcloudError(value=('Booted single node[%s], ' % node
> + 'but multiple nodes have same UUID'),
> driver=self)
> if (len(nodes) == 1 and nodes[0].public_ips and nodes[0].state ==
> NodeState.RUNNING):
> return nodes[0]
> else:
> time.sleep(wait_period)
> continue
